The correct tyre pressure for your Peugeot can typically be found on a sticker located on the driver's side doorjamb or in your vehicle's owner's manual. Maintaining the correct tyre pressure is crucial for optimal handling, fuel efficiency, and tyre life. Regularly check and adjust your tyre pressure to the manufacturer's recommended levels. Here are some reference examples:
- Peugeot 208 (2020 onwards): 32 PSI (front), 29 PSI (rear)
- Peugeot 3008 (2021 onwards): 35 PSI (front), 32 PSI (rear)
- Peugeot 508 (2022 onwards): 36 PSI (front), 33 PSI (rear)
